So again, you take a something from EL and to APC and spin it to scare people. The 824 arbitration settlement is clear, they can offer all the test they want but they can't turn someone down. Post the language of the 824 LOA and the letter that AA sent to the flow guys.

824 LOA, 5.f

"Interview - Eagle pilots who are offered pilot employment at AA under the provisions of this Letter will not be required to undergo any portion of an employment interview at AA.

The union is seeking clarification from management, the language is clear, even if there is a grievance it will be reviewed in an expedited process and they are already meeting with management and the arbitrator before Thanksgiving.
